HB2924 by Geren (Relating to the addition of territory to a public improvement district.), As Engrossed

No fiscal implication to the State is anticipated.

The bill would authorize a municipality to add territory in the municipality or its extraterritorial jurisdiction to a public improvement district created by the municipality, if requested via a petition signed by a certain number of applicable property owners. The bill would also authorize a county to add territory in the county to a public improvement district created by the county if requested via a petition signed by a certain number of applicable property owners.

The bill would take effect immediately if it receives a two-thirds vote in each house; otherwise, it would take effect September 1, 2003.

Various local government associations were contacted regarding the estimated fiscal impact of the provisions of the bill.


Local Government Impact

No significant fiscal implication to units of local government is anticipated.
